depth

noun B2

Meaning

Depth refers to the quality of being deep, often used to describe physical measurements, emotional complexity, or the intensity of knowledge in a particular area.
💡 A common mistake is to confuse "depth" with "deepness," as "depth" is the preferred term in most contexts.

Example Sentences

The depth of the lake surprised the new swimmers .
The depth of the pool is two meters .
The depth of the report reveals important insights into the issue .
What is the depth of the swimming pool here ?
